Producer Information
Established in 2000, Cedric Bouchard created his own Champagne House, Roses de Jeanne. Based in Aube, with originally only 1.09ha under vines he has now established Roses de Jeanne as one of the most promising small Champagne producers. Bouchard focuses on bio-dynamic production and champions the Pinot Noir grape variety. Since the beginning, he embraced the philosophy of; single vineyard, single variety (Pinot Noir, Chardonnay or Pinot Blanc), single vintage, zero dosage Champagnes.tage. The Domaine continues to grow and evolve. Bouchard increased his holdings by combining 1.37 hectares of vines previously owned by his father, with his own assortment of prime parcels. Although his father's holdings were originally bottled under the Inflorescence label, beginning in 2014 all cuvées were bottled under the Roses de Jeanne label.
